If you’re planning a beach family session with young children, choosing the right time of day is everything. Summer brings later sunsets, which can make evening sessions tricky for babies and toddlers. Booking a sunrise or early morning session can make all the difference when it comes to keeping your kids happy and relaxed. While summer sunset beach sessions are undeniably beautiful, the timing you choose will directly impact your child’s mood, the lighting, and your overall experience. Soft, Dreamy Light That Photographs Beautifully
One of the biggest advantages of booking a sunrise session is the light and avoiding the insane beach summer crowds. Early morning light is soft, warm, and flattering, creating beautiful images. It does involve waking up early, but isn’t that inevitable with a toddler!
Sunset Is Very Late in the Summer
During summer, sunset is typically very late — often around 8:00–8:15 PM depending on the time of year. For many Orange County families, this is simply too late for young children and would require us to start around 7pm to get that pretty softer lighting.
This is why many I highly recommend sunrise or early morning sessions instead. You still get beautiful coastal light without pushing into your child’s evening routine. Then, you have the rest of the day to enjoy as a family!

Fewer Crowds and a More Relaxed Environment
Summer mornings at the beach are noticeably quieter. Some of my favorite locations, like Newport Beach and Laguna Beach, feel especially peaceful early in the day, before the crowds roll in and before there are people unintentionally photo bombing every moment.

For the best results, as a family photographer in Orange County I suggest:
Early morning summer sessions: around 7–7:30 AM, depending on cloud cover and weather conditions.
This window offers soft, even light, cooler temperatures, and a calm, quiet beach before crowds roll in. It also tends to be the easiest time for little ones—kids are usually well-rested, happier, and more cooperative earlier in the day.
You’ll also avoid harsh midday sun, which can create strong shadows and squinting, especially on bright summer days. Parking is easier, the beaches feel more peaceful, and we have more flexibility to move around and use the best spots without distractions.
